ALEXANDRIA, Va., Dec. 23 -- United States Patent no. 12,503,068, issued on Dec. 23, was assigned to HITACHI ASTEMO LTD. (Hitachinaka, Japan).
"Vehicle control device" was invented by Motomune Suzuki (Tokyo) and Hideyuki Sakamoto (Tokyo).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"The present disclosure provides a vehicle control device capable of detecting overheating of a CPU or a heat dissipation failure of the cooling mechanism, while suppressing increases in the size, the number of components, and the cost. A vehicle control device according to the present embodiment includes a memory, a CPU, a temperature sensor that is provided internal of the CPU, and a cooling mechanism that cools the CPU.
